What a superb mouth-to-mouth resuscitation class feels like

The base test for mouth-to-mouth resuscitation training newcastle is just how your chest compression technique takes care of 10 mins of exertion, not the initial thirty seconds. Real exhaustion exposes shallow compressions and inconsistent rate. Manikins with comments displays assist you appropriate deepness and recoil in real time. The best cpr training course newcastle sessions run numerous cycles with brief rests, because that is where your method improves and your self-confidence settles.

Breaths matter as well. The pendulum swings every few years between compression-only and compressions plus rescue breaths. In grown-up out-of-hospital apprehensions, compression-only mouth-to-mouth resuscitation is an acceptable bridge when a barrier device is not readily available, but your evaluation will certainly need both compressions and breaths. Your instructor needs to explain nuance: drowning and paediatric instances need air flows early, opioid overdoses gain from ventilations while you provide naloxone if trained, and serious anaphylaxis can need hostile airway positioning. You want a course that does not give you mottos, it gives you judgment.

Certificates, legitimacy, and timelines that catch individuals out

An emergency treatment certificate newcastle tied to HLTAID011 normally remains current for 3 years. Mouth-to-mouth resuscitation money is 12 months under the majority of workplace plans and insurance company expectations. Individuals usually forget this and publication a solitary refresher course late, which can produce conformity gaps. If your function is examined or you function under a top quality framework, established schedule pointers at 10 and 11 months for CPR, and at 33 months for very first aid.

Childcare credentials follow stricter settings in numerous solutions, prompting yearly mouth-to-mouth resuscitation and more frequent bronchial asthma and anaphylaxis refreshers. Paediatrics, bronchial asthma, and anaphylaxis: the three scenarios parents remember

Parents, carers, and early childhood years educators typically ask for specifics about respiratory tract management for children, asthma action plans, and anaphylaxis. A solid first aid and mouth-to-mouth resuscitation course newcastle will certainly provide you experiment paediatric manikins and spacer strategies. For bronchial asthma, the four-by-four regulation (4 smokes, 4 breaths per puff, repeat after four minutes if required) remains common, but fitness instructors ought to tie it back to the casualty's created plan.

For anaphylaxis, you will manage multiple autoinjector types. In the last couple of years, I have seen much more confusion about the length of time to hold the device in place and whether a 2nd dosage is secure. You will discover to hold for 3 seconds in the majority of existing devices, massage is not called for, and a 2nd dosage after 5 mins serves if signs and symptoms continue. Not every training course enters into nuances like biphasic responses, however great ones a minimum of prepare you for prolonged monitoring up until the ambulance arrives.

Common myths that throw away time

I still hear these in Newcastle classrooms.

You needs to check for a pulse prior to starting mouth-to-mouth resuscitation. In out-of-hospital settings, pulse checks delay action and are unreliable. If the individual is unresponsive and not breathing typically, start compressions.

image

You will certainly break ribs if you push hard sufficient. You might, particularly in older grownups. Proper depth issues greater than worry of a crack. Broken ribs recover, heart attack does not.

Only experienced individuals should use an AED. Gadgets are created for untrained spectators. They are risk-free, they self-analyse, and they will certainly not surprise unless indicated.

Someone having a seizure needs to be restrained or have something put in their mouth. Never restrain or place things in the mouth. Protect the head, clear the area, time the seizure, and take care of the air passage afterward.
